The Kennedy Fighting Irish's's three-game losing streak came to an end on Friday. They were the clear victor by a 41-17 margin over Valencia. The result was nothing new for Kennedy, who have now won five matches by 20 points or more so far this season.
Devin Almazan looked great while leading his team to the win, throwing for 207 yards and four touchdowns. Izaiah Murphy was another key contributor, picking up 53 receiving yards and two touchdowns.
Although Valencia took the loss, they still got scores from Nicholas Sandoval and Charles Denny.
Kennedy's victory bumped their record up to 6-3. As for Valencia, their defeat was their third straight on the road, which dropped their overall record down to 3-6.
Kennedy will square off against Crean Lutheran at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. As for Valencia, they will be playing at home against Pacifica at 7:00 p.m. on Friday.
